I have an s reg Honda Shuttle and have just had a new rad fitted. when I
put on the blowers warm air comes through even when it is set oncool

S-reg should be a '99.

Check the wire cable that goes to the heater control valve under the bonnet
near the bulkhead. It's probably slipped off the post.

If this is the case here, there is a quick fix that involves a piece of
clear vinyl tubing.
